LV= has published a new version of its Little Book of Protection.
The free updated book is designed for advisers to use as an aid in their conversations with clients, on the different types of protection available.
The book looks at the different types of cover available and also the different lifestyle aspects that could be an important trigger and create a need for protection.
For example, LV= says the average new family car costs £5,869 annually to keep on the road, and between the ages of one and four a child costs their parents an average of £53,586.
